When you made your wizard years ago, and now realize that people can tease you of sorts because of your wizard's name not matching their school, or having weird starter hair, you kind of wish you had the option to change everything you could personalize at the beginning of making a character, and I'm sure many people can relate.

Now, my only option to change my wizards name and face is to start over my wizard, but being a level 90 Ice, I don't really have the time, patience, or money to start over my ice. I know this has been asked a lot, but can we please have something in the crown shop to change the face/facial expression, basic hair, name, and basic clothing for something like 5000 crowns?

Now the only problem that I see with adding this is people unfriending their old friends because they don't recognize them at all. Below I will provide the format of this solution, over the friends list.

() Marcus WinterBreeze
(Mark EmeraldThorn)

My new name would be shown first, and then my old name would be shown under. Clicking either of my names would show my new face, (and my gear of course). To see my old looks, you could click a circular button labeled "See Old View," which would be located to the right of the friend's name, moving the name slightly to the left. The art is for this button would probably be like the basic circle face split down the middle sort of like DC's "Two Face."

Thank you for taking your time to read this, if you have any problems with this suggestion, please comments your concerns, and I will do my best to address them. Please leave any feedback or suggestions about this add on to the crown shop that I think would be really nice! I know I tried to make this suggestion before, but I think my old one was poorly crafted and had weak points. Also, I still think 5000 crowns is a reasonable price for a name/face/hair/etc. change.

KI is not going to allow name changes for wizards. That alone would create some problems that in reality could result in the loss of your wizard entirely due to what has already been registered in your account.....All wizard names are tied directly to that account.

What you propose would create even more problems. Many of us have created wizards early in the game that we don't particularly like but if we all requested name changes or appearance changes, it would create chaos for the system.

changing a name is problematic; but there have been many posts over the years requesting an option to change basic appearance for crowns (similar to how you can buy back training points).

I agree with the appearance change option; someone new to the game doesn't realize it is a permanent choice (like me years back). There are wigs etc. but would be nice to don some traditional hats with a hairstyle you are happy with.
